Abstract

Based on the approximation of the linear operator semigroup, this paper proposes a simplified viscosity splitting method for solving the initial boundary value problems of the N-S equation. Some stability and convergence estimates of the method are proved. In particular, the mechanism of Chorin's method is explained and justified by the splitting method.
